There are two powerful forces that will impact your life. One impacts your life negatively and one impacts your life positively. These forces are controlled by you and the choices you make. The negative force will destroy your life and future. The positive force will ensure your success in life, both now and forevermore. These two forces are sin and prayer.

Sin is disobedience to God and his word to us, the Bible. The Bible is full of instruction and commandments, but when asked what commandment was the most important, Jesus answered: “You shall love the Lord your God with all your heart and with all your soul and with all your mind. This is the great and first commandment. And a second is like it: You shall love your neighbor as yourself" (Matthew 22:37-39).

Jesus sums up the entire Bible with this great commandment of loving God and loving people. When we are not loving God with our whole being, we are sinning. Any time we do not love others, treating them as we desire to be treated, we are sinning.

Sin is powerful and left unchecked it will destroy us and those around us. It is a powerful force that will impact your life in negative ways.

Prayer is powerful and will impact your life in positive ways. Prayer is not difficult. Prayer is simply having a transparent conversation with God. Notice that I say transparent conversation, meaning that we hide nothing from God. Instead, we talk to him about everything in our life, including our weaknesses and our failures. We cannot hide anything from God, no matter how hard we try. He knows all and it is best that we talk to him about everything.

When we sin, it takes prayer to seek God's forgiveness. The Bible tells us, "If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just to forgive us our sins and to cleanse us from all unrighteousness" (1 John 1:9).

Friend, if you have sinned, talk to God about it. Own it and don't blame it on others. Confess it to God. He will forgive you and he will cleanse you.

Do you have a besetting sin that controls you? Do you try to change but you keep going back to the same sin? Ask God to fill you full of his Holy Spirit. The Holy Spirit is God's gift to you that will help you with your sin problem.

Take everything to God in prayer. I'm convinced that the more we pray, having transparent conversations with God, the less we will sin. The reverse is also in play. The more casual we are with sin, the less we will pray.

Beloved, let prayer prevail in your life. Make it a priority. As you do, you will get to a point where you are continually talking to God throughout your day. As a result, your day will be blessed.
